Umicore SA Statistics Share Statistics Umicore SA has 240.48M
shares outstanding. The number of shares has increased by 0.03%
in one year.
Shares Outstanding 240.48M Shares Change (YoY) 0.03% Shares Change (QoQ) 0% Owned by Institutions (%) n/a Shares Floating 184.13M Failed to Deliver (FTD) Shares n/a FTD / Avg. Volume n/a
Short Selling Information Short Interest n/a Short % of Shares Out n/a Short % of Float n/a Short Ratio (days to cover) n/a
Valuation Ratios The PE ratio is -1.58 and the forward
PE ratio is null.
Umicore SA's PEG ratio is
0.
PE Ratio -1.58 Forward PE n/a PS Ratio 0.16 Forward PS n/a PB Ratio 1.21 P/FCF Ratio 8.16 PEG Ratio 0
Financial Ratio History Enterprise Valuation Currently the Enterprise Value (EV) is not available for Umicore SA.
EV / Sales n/a EV / EBITDA n/a EV / EBIT n/a EV / FCF n/a
Financial Position The company has a current ratio of 1.29,
with a Debt / Equity ratio of 0.
Current Ratio 1.29 Quick Ratio 0.77 Debt / Equity 0 Debt / EBITDA n/a Debt / FCF n/a Interest Coverage -9.01
Financial Efficiency Return on Equity is n/a and Return on Invested Capital is n/a.
Return on Equity n/a Return on Assets n/a Return on Invested Capital n/a Revenue Per Employee $1.32M Profits Per Employee $-131.53K Employee Count 11,251 Asset Turnover 1.58 Inventory Turnover 5.62
Taxes Income Tax 107M Effective Tax Rate -7.51%
Stock Price Statistics The stock price has increased by -60.84% in the
last 52 weeks. The beta is 0.73, so Umicore SA's
price volatility has been higher than the market average.
Beta 0.73 52-Week Price Change -60.84% 50-Day Moving Average 9.41 200-Day Moving Average 11.02 Relative Strength Index (RSI) 62.11 Average Volume (20 Days) 663
Income Statement In the last 12 months, Umicore SA had revenue of 14.85B
and earned -1.48B
in profits. Earnings per share was -6.15.
Revenue 14.85B Gross Profit 2.21B Operating Income -1.26B Net Income -1.48B EBITDA 432.6M EBIT -1.28B Earnings Per Share (EPS) -6.15
Full Income Statement Balance Sheet The company has 2.01B in cash and 0 in
debt, giving a net cash position of 2.01B.
Cash & Cash Equivalents 2.01B Total Debt n/a Net Cash n/a Retained Earnings 1.07B Total Assets 9.41B Working Capital 1.26B
Full Balance Sheet Cash Flow In the last 12 months, operating cash flow was 868.7M
and capital expenditures -582.2M, giving a free cash flow of 286.5M.
Operating Cash Flow 868.7M Capital Expenditures -582.2M Free Cash Flow 286.5M FCF Per Share 1.19
Full Cash Flow Statement Margins Gross margin is 14.88%, with operating and profit margins of -8.5% and -9.96%.
Gross Margin 14.88% Operating Margin -8.5% Pretax Margin -9.59% Profit Margin -9.96% EBITDA Margin 2.91% EBIT Margin -8.5% FCF Margin 1.93%
Dividends & Yields UMICF pays an annual dividend of $1.11,
which amounts to a dividend yield of 5.23%.
Dividend Per Share $1.11 Dividend Yield 5.23% Dividend Growth (YoY) -68.44% Payout Ratio -15.93% Earnings Yield n/a FCF Yield n/a
Dividend Details Analyst Forecast Currently there are no analyst rating for UMICF.
Price Target n/a Price Target Difference n/a Analyst Consensus n/a Analyst Count n/a
Stock Forecasts Fair Value There are several formulas that can be used to estimate the
intrinsic value of a stock.
Lynch Fair Value n/a Lynch Upside n/a Graham Number n/a Graham Upside n/a
Stock Splits The last stock split was on Oct 16, 2017. It was a
forward
split with a ratio of 2:1.
Last Split Date Oct 16, 2017 Split Type forward Split Ratio 2:1
Scores Altman Z-Score 4.85 Piotroski F-Score 5